We have just added 2 new features to your MainWP Members area, Your Dashboards and Cron Jobs.

member-dashboards

The “Your Dashboards” feature allows you to disable a MainWP Dashboard from your account without needing to contact support. This is especially helpful to users who want to change where there Dashboard is installed.

MainWP Cron Jobs

The “Cron Jobs” feature was created to send a web request via the Members area to your MainWP Dashboard. Some of the features such as backups and updates are triggered via the built in WP-Cron function.

The issue that arose is that we suggest you setup MainWP on a new domain or sub-domain and that site probably gets no traffic. However, the WP-Cron function requires traffic so if you didn’t visit your Dashboard the Wp-Cron didn’t fire and didn’t trigger the Dashboard features to run.

Our solution was to setup a web request via cron job to trigger those jobs each and everyday. The Cron Jobs page will tell you the last time the WP-Cron file was contacted and if there were any failures reaching that page.
